As nouns, grumpiness is a hyponym of ill nature; that is, grumpiness is a word with a more specific, narrower meaning than ill nature:
  • ill nature: a disagreeable, irritable, or malevolent disposition
  • grumpiness: a fussy and eccentric disposition
